Pregnancy bleeding refers to vaginal spotting or bleeding, which usually occurs in the first trimester. It is relatively common during the early weeks of pregnancy compared to later stages, and in many cases, it may not be a serious issue. However, every pregnancy is different, and their challenges associated with it highlight the importance of timely medical evaluation, which ensures the health and well-being of the mother and the baby.

Bleeding during the first trimester is not uncommon and may occur due to few harmless reasons. But it should not be ignored, as bleeding can sometimes be a sign of an underlying concern that needs medical attention. As the pregnancy progresses and the second or third trimester begins, bleeding can be a concerning situation and might lead to various complications such as preterm labour, placental abruption, and placental previa, and also risk the baby’s growth and development.

First trimester bleeding can be caused by various reasons, including hormonal changes, changes in the cervix, ectopic pregnancy, cervical polyps, and implantation bleeding.

Warning Signs You Must Look For

Although mild spotting during early pregnancy might not be as serious an issue; however, if you are noticing any one or more of the following symptoms, you must consult your healthcare provider.

–          Severe abdominal or pelvic pain

–          Menstrual cramp like pain

–          Passage of clot/ tissues

–          Bleeding after a fall or an injury

–          Heavy bleeding, soaking a pad

–          Fever or chills

What Causes Early Pregnancy Bleeding?

Here are some of the common causes of early pregnancy bleeding:

–          Implantation bleeding

–          Hormonal changes

–          Ectopic pregnancy

–          Miscarriage

–          Molar pregnancy

–          Cervical irritation

–          Cervical polyps

Treatment options for early pregnancy bleeding depend on the causes and severity of the condition. Here are some ways to manage the condition:

–          Rest and observation

Doctors usually recommend complete rest for women who are experiencing bleeding during early pregnancy caused by implantation or cervical irritation. You must avoid strenuous activities, heavy lifting and long travel if you are noticing signs of bleeding in pregnancy, usually in the first trimester.

–          Medications

Certain medicines, such as progesterone supplements, pain relievers, and antibiotics, may be recommended depending on the underlying causes of bleeding. These medicines can help support the pregnancy, reduce discomfort and treat any infections that may lead to bleeding.

–          Managing cervical or uterine conditions

If the bleeding is caused by cervical polyps, infections or issues related to the uterine lining, your doctor may recommend specific treatments that address the root cause.
